O que é ticket?
No contexto do desenvolvimento de aplicativos móveis, o termo “ticket” refere-se a uma unidade de trabalho ou uma solicitação que precisa ser atendida por uma equipe de desenvolvimento. Os tickets são frequentemente utilizados em sistemas de gerenciamento de projetos e ferramentas de rastreamento de problemas, permitindo que as equipes organizem e priorizem tarefas de forma eficiente. Cada ticket contém informações detalhadas sobre a tarefa, como descrição, prioridade, status e responsável, facilitando a comunicação entre os membros da equipe.
Tipos de tickets
Existem diferentes tipos de tickets que podem ser criados durante o desenvolvimento de um aplicativo móvel. Os tickets de bug, por exemplo, são utilizados para relatar falhas ou problemas encontrados no aplicativo. Já os tickets de feature são usados para solicitar novas funcionalidades ou melhorias. Além disso, tickets de suporte podem ser gerados para atender a dúvidas ou problemas enfrentados pelos usuários finais. Cada tipo de ticket tem um fluxo de trabalho específico, que ajuda a equipe a gerenciar as demandas de forma mais eficaz.
Importância dos tickets no desenvolvimento ágil
No desenvolvimento ágil, os tickets desempenham um papel fundamental na organização do trabalho. Eles permitem que as equipes priorizem tarefas com base nas necessidades do cliente e no valor que cada tarefa traz para o produto final. A utilização de tickets ajuda a manter o foco nas entregas mais importantes, garantindo que a equipe esteja sempre alinhada com os objetivos do projeto. Além disso, os tickets facilitam a transparência e a colaboração entre os membros da equipe, uma vez que todos podem visualizar o progresso das tarefas em tempo real.
Ferramentas de gerenciamento de tickets
Existem diversas ferramentas de gerenciamento de tickets disponíveis no mercado, cada uma com suas características e funcionalidades. Ferramentas como Jira, Trello e Asana são amplamente utilizadas por equipes de desenvolvimento para criar, rastrear e gerenciar tickets. Essas plataformas oferecem recursos como categorização de tickets, atribuição de responsáveis, definição de prazos e relatórios de progresso, permitindo que as equipes mantenham um controle rigoroso sobre o andamento das tarefas e a qualidade do produto final.
Como criar um ticket eficaz
Para que um ticket seja eficaz, é importante que ele contenha informações claras e detalhadas. Um bom ticket deve incluir uma descrição precisa do problema ou solicitação, passos para reproduzir o bug (quando aplicável), a prioridade da tarefa e a data de entrega esperada. Além disso, é essencial que o ticket seja atribuído a um membro da equipe responsável por sua resolução. A clareza e a objetividade nas informações ajudam a evitar mal-entendidos e garantem que a equipe possa trabalhar de forma mais produtiva.
O ciclo de vida de um ticket
O ciclo de vida de um ticket geralmente passa por várias etapas, desde a criação até a resolução. Inicialmente, o ticket é criado e atribuído a um responsável. Em seguida, ele pode ser classificado como “em andamento” quando o trabalho começa, e “concluído” quando a tarefa é finalizada. Algumas ferramentas de gerenciamento de tickets também permitem que os tickets sejam reabertos caso o problema persista ou novas informações sejam adicionadas. Esse ciclo de vida ajuda a manter um registro claro do progresso e das ações tomadas em relação a cada ticket.
Benefícios do uso de tickets
O uso de tickets traz diversos benefícios para equipes de desenvolvimento de aplicativos móveis. Um dos principais benefícios é a melhoria na organização e na priorização das tarefas, o que resulta em uma maior eficiência no fluxo de trabalho. Além disso, os tickets ajudam a documentar o histórico de problemas e soluções, o que pode ser valioso para futuras referências. A comunicação entre os membros da equipe também é aprimorada, pois todos têm acesso às informações relevantes sobre cada tarefa, evitando retrabalho e mal-entendidos.
Desafios no gerenciamento de tickets
Apesar dos benefícios, o gerenciamento de tickets também pode apresentar desafios. Um dos principais problemas é a sobrecarga de tickets, que pode ocorrer quando muitas tarefas são criadas ao mesmo tempo, dificultando a priorização e a resolução eficiente. Além disso, a falta de informações claras nos tickets pode levar a confusões e atrasos. Para mitigar esses desafios, é importante que as equipes estabeleçam processos claros para a criação e o gerenciamento de tickets, garantindo que todos os membros estejam alinhados e cientes das prioridades.
Conclusão sobre tickets no desenvolvimento de apps
Os tickets são uma ferramenta essencial no desenvolvimento de aplicativos móveis, permitindo que as equipes organizem, priorizem e gerenciem suas tarefas de forma eficaz. Com a utilização adequada de tickets, as equipes podem melhorar sua produtividade, comunicação e qualidade do produto final. A adoção de boas práticas no gerenciamento de tickets é fundamental para garantir que o fluxo de trabalho seja otimizado e que as demandas dos usuários sejam atendidas de maneira eficiente.